Job Title: Oracle Cloud Business Analyst
Location: San Jose- California (Remote)
Job Type: Contract
Client: Direct Client
Job Details:
Job Summary: We are seeking an experienced and detail-oriented Oracle Cloud Business Analyst & Application System Administrator to lead and support the implementation, optimization, and administration of Oracle Cloud Applications (primarily in the Supply Chain and Manufacturing domains). This role requires strong functional and technical knowledge in Bill of Materials (BOM) configuration, Engineering Change Order (ECO) processes, traceability, and approved vendor management strategies.
The ideal candidate will act as a key liaison between business stakeholders, IT, and external vendors to ensure best practices and system integrity across product lifecycle and supply chain operations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Configure and maintain Oracle Cloud modules, including Product Management (PDH), BOM, Costing, and Procurement, with a focus on engineering and manufacturing operations.
- Design and optimize multi-level BOM structures, component relationships, and change control processes (ECOs) in alignment with engineering and supply chain best practices.
- Manage Item Master data governance, including lifecycle states, attribute validation, and integration with PLM systems.
- Implement and enforce traceability strategies, ensuring end-to-end tracking of materials, assemblies, and finished goods in compliance with regulatory or industry standards.
- Support the Approved Vendor List (AVL) setup, including sourcing rules, supplier qualifications, and change impact assessments.
- Lead cross-functional workshops to gather requirements, define user stories, and recommend scalable Oracle Cloud solutions.
- Serve as the system administrator for Oracle Cloud Application modules, managing configurations, workflows, user roles, and access controls.
- Develop and maintain documentation for system configurations, test scripts, user training, and change management.
- Monitor, troubleshoot, and resolve system issues; manage Oracle SRs (Service Requests) when needed.
- Participate in testing, validation, and deployment of Oracle updates and patches.
- Collaborate with IT, Engineering, Supply Chain, Quality, and Finance to drive continuous improvement in ERP performance and data integrity.
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or s degree in information systems, Engineering, Supply Chain, or a related field.
- 5+ years of hands-on experience with Oracle Cloud Applications (Fusion ERP) in a business analyst or admin role.
- Deep knowledge of BOM configuration, ECO processes, and product lifecycle management (PLM).
- Strong understanding of manufacturing traceability, lot/serial control, and compliance workflows.
- Proven experience with Approved Vendor List (AVL) strategy and supplier management best practices.
- Ability to write functional specifications, perform data mapping, and lead UAT.
- Experience with data migration, system integrations, and API usage preferred.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Oracle Cloud Certifications (e.g., Oracle Fusion SCM or Product Management).
- Experience in regulated industries (e.g., medical device, automotive, aerospace).
- Familiarity with Agile methodologies and ticket management tools like JIRA or ServiceNow.
- Knowledge of PLM systems such as Agile PLM, Arena, or Windchill.
